To receive an update on the Local Plan examination, to note the contents of the Inspector’s Post Hearing letter and the ‘focused consultation’ on three technical evidence documents supporting the Fareham Local Plan 2037.
The Fareham Local Plan 2037 (the ‘Local Plan’) is at examination stage and the hearings concluded in early April. In early June, the Council received a ‘Post Hearings’ letter from the Planning Inspector outlining her areas of outstanding concern and stating her findings on changes required to enable the Plan to proceed.
The Inspector’s Post Hearing letter provides her findings on a number of areas where the Inspector has some concern. In some places, she has provided a clear steer on changes which she feels are necessary to achieve a sound plan. Some of these relate to sites, others to policy areas and one provides a choice to the Council.
The Inspector’s Post Hearing letter contains her findings on three elements of the Local Plan housing supply which have implications for parts of the technical evidence base. These three elements are the removal of two allocations, pushing the housing delivery at Welborne Garden Village back a year and reducing the overall contribution from Welborne across the plan period.
The Inspector has asked that the implications of these changes are included in a revised Housing Supply Topic Paper and that, alongside a revised Affordable Housing topic paper and the Windfall Analysis Update paper (May 2022), the Council undertake a focused consultation on technical housing matters with those representors who either commented on the policy area or attended the hearing session on this matter. The Inspector has requested that the Council comment on the consultation responses, instead of responding directly itself. Following the suggested three-week consultation and the receipt of the responses and Council comments, the Inspector will advise further on these matters.
The Inspector has requested a formal response from the Council on the Post Hearings letter and it is proposed to respond in early August after the focused consultation has concluded.
This report asks that Executive note the content of the Post Hearing letter and that the focused consultation on technical housing matters will begin shortly. This report also seeks delegated authority to respond in full to the Inspector’s Post Hearing letter.
The report also sets out the likely next steps of Local Plan progression through to the end of the examination process and adoption.

To set out details of the Government’s UK Shared Prosperity Fund (UKSPF) and outline a way forward for the use of the Council’s funding allocation.
The government launched its UK Shared Prosperity Fund (UKSPF) this year, as part of its Levelling Up agenda. It provides £2.6 billion of funding intended to reduce inequalities between communities. The funding covers the three year period up to March 2025, and Fareham Borough Council has been allocated a total of £1m.
As lead authority, the Council must submit a plan of how the funding shall be used, and the positive outcomes that can be expected as a result of the projects it funds.
The report sets out a set of proposals for how the funding could be used, namely:-
· A programme of business support, prioritising proposals that strengthen the retail offer in district and local centres, improve the attractiveness of district and local retail centres, or support the objective of achieving net zero carbon/increase investment in green growth
If the proposals are supported, and following a series of stakeholder engagement measures, the proposals will be submitted to the Government by the deadline of 1st August 2022.

To endorse the establishment of a Forum to engage neighbouring communities and other interested parties in the ongoing development of Welborne Garden Village.
The establishment of the Welborne Community Forum will provide the opportunity for the local authorities, the master developer, residents, neighbouring communities and other interested parties to engage regularly on the delivery of Welborne Garden Village.
